Default Burping/Bleeding Coolant System

How do you burp/bleed your coolant system on a 95 EX motor. I know there is a nipple that you are supposed to open that is located where the top radiator hose connects to the head, but are you supposed to take the radiator cap off fill it up and then start the car. If so what do you do after that and how do you know if it is done.

Default Re: Burping/Bleeding Coolant System

Just start the car with the radiator cap off and let it run through. As you see the level go down, add coolant to it.

No major surgery involved.

Default Re: Burping/Bleeding Coolant System

not all single cam's have that nipple. sometimes they are on the thermostat housing. what i usually do is just add coolant while squeezing the lower hose to burp it until it's topped off. then i'll start the car and let it run for a bit and add coolant as necessary.
